Output f583bc380a2bfdcb1a0907b5efb1ae52d2e3fc88de2149e16944faec36b48dc7:0

value
106726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d673f3dc328682f00d2fa6ca3acb1072f9624d OP_EQUAL
address
3ESQkfDM5Mux8pk2skfXT4VXPBxPxTZULZ
transaction
f583bc380a2bfdcb1a0907b5efb1ae52d2e3fc88de2149e16944faec36b48dc7
confirmations
102350
spent
true